Opis:
Changes in energy fuel markets, the rise of renewables and the aging of existing coal-fired units are leading to increased popularization of research on potential pathways for restructuring power systems. One proposed concept is the Coal-toNuclear path, which involves the partial use of existing coal-fired power plant infrastructure in favor of the construction of nuclear units, which can reduce investment costs. An additional benefit is the ability to manage the workforce competencies identified within the coal-fired power unit, and which are also required for the effective operation of the nuclear unit. The article considers the possibility of repowering the Kozienice power plant in Poland from the perspective of the availability of water used to cool the power units. Three different nuclear reactor technologies that are potentially being considered for the construction of the first nuclear units in Poland were analyzed. The study showed that the lowest water flows in the Vistula river recorded in 2022, equal to 146 m3 /s, make it impossible to simultaneously cool the nuclear units and ensure sufficiently low water temperatures from an environmental perspective. Nuclear units were shown to require about 1.55−1.67 times more water for cooling than typical coal-fired units.

Opis:
Agricultural production of most smallholders in Ethiopia is dependent with recurrent rainfall resulted in production variations. Limited input availability and precarious environmental conditions determine smallholders’ decisions on their production and the production efficiencies vary from farmer to farmer. This study was carried out with the aim of analyzing the technical, allocative and economic efficiencies of smallholder farmers in the production of major crops and their determinants in central Ethiopia, Oromia special zone surrounding Addis Ababa. Multistage sampling technique was employed to randomly and proportionally select 386 smallholders from ten PAs. Primary data were collected from smallholders through a semi structured questionnaire using face to face interview. Cross sectional data collected from sampled households in the study area were analyzed using mathematical and econometric methods. Mathematical programming technique selected for this study was Data Envelopment Analysis (DEA) using linear programming technique assuming multi-input and multi-outputs were handled. Tobit regression model was regressed against the socioeconomic, demographic, and institutional variables that are expected to affect the technical, allocative and economic efficiencies of sampled households. The results of estimated efficiency scores show the mean technical, allocative and economic efficiencies were 0.75, 0.60 and 0.45 respectively. The mean scores of efficiencies show underutilization of resources and the possibilities of smallholders to increase their agricultural production by 25%, and reduce cost of production by 40% and total cost by 55%. Marital status, level of education, farming experience, access to credit, cooperative membership, access to farming information, and off/non-farm income has positive influence on the technical, allocative and economic efficiencies. While age of the household head, access to training and livestock size has negative relations to efficiencies. Delivery of agricultural inputs and trainings on time by the government is the key policy implication to improve the efficiencies of smallholders.

Opis:
The efficient recovery of the waste heat from the industrial sector can represent an essential step in global energy saving, with the proper usage of other on-grid power resources available for specific high-energy consumers. A simple, low–cost energy conversion system was tested here to recover a part of the waste heat dissipated by a gasoline engine’s exhaust pipe under the car’s stationary testing mode at temperatures around 80–100°C. The main components of this system were a copper–made thermal collector, a commercial thermoelectric energy generator (TEG) module TEC1–12706 and a pin-fin heat sink under natural air convection cooling. Under the open-circuit test, heat transfer rates between 4.54 W and 5.56 W were evacuated by the heat sink. A DC electronic load RL was connected at the TEG outputs, and voltage values between 0.566 V and 1.242 V were recorded for output power values between 0.03 W and 0.16 W when R,sub>L was modified from 1 Ω to 10 Ω.

Opis:
The paper deals with increasing processes efficiency at a production line of cylinder heads of engines in a production company operating in the automotive industry. The goal is to achieve improvement and optimization of test processes on a production line. It analyzes options for improving capacity, availability and productivity of processes of an output test by using modern technology available on the market. We have focused on analysis of operation times before and after optimization of test processes at specific production sections. By analyzing measured results we have determined differences in time before and after improvement of the process. We have determined a coefficient of efficiency OEE and by comparing outputs we have confirmed real improvement of the process of the output test of cylinder heads.

Opis:
We suggest original modifications and extensions of the recently presented methodological developments in ex-post accounting framework in global value chains in order to obtain empirical results both for the analyzed group of ten CEE economies as well as at a country-and-sectorspecific level. The empirical results confirm that the role of the selected CEE economies in transition in creating value added with respect to the total value added in the European Union in the GVC framework was biggest in the cases of agriculture-, wood-products-, metal-production, and travel-and-tourism-related sectors. We also found that, after two decades of transition, the measures of productivity in the examined economies in 2009 were still much lower as compared to the EU average for most of the sectors. Moreover, in the transition period, these indexes were increasing, especially after EU accession. In contrary, after two decades of transition, the measures of capital efficiency in the ten CEE economies in 2009 were comparable to the EU average for most of the sectors. Moreover, during this period, the growth rates of these indexes were, in general, positive. However, their growth rates dropped after EU accession.

Opis:
In this study, dynamical parameters of the cycloidal gearbox working at the constant angular velocity of the input shaft were investigated in the multibody dynamics 2D model implemented in the Fortran programming language. Time courses of input and output torques and forces acting on the internal and external sleeves have been shown as a function of the contact modelling parameters and backlash. The analysis results in the model implemented in Fortran were compared with the results in the 3D model designed using MSC Adams software. The values of contact forces are similar in both models. However, in the time courses obtained in MSC Adams there are numerical singularities in the form of peaks reaching 500 N for the forces at external sleeves and 400 N for the forces acting at internal sleeves, whereas in the Fortran model, there are fewer singularities and the maximum values of contact forces at internal and external sleeves do not exceed 200 N. The contact damping and discretisation level (the number of discrete contact points on the cycloidal wheels) significantly affect the accuracy of the results. The accuracy of computations improves when contact damping and discretisation are high. The disadvantage of the high discretization is the extended analysis time. High backlash values lead to a rise in contact forces and a decrease in the force acting time. The model implemented in Fortran gives a fast solution and performs well in the gearbox optimisation process. A reduction of cycloidal wheel discretisation to 600 points, which still allows satisfactory analysis, could reduce the solution time to 4 min, corresponding to an analysis time of 0.6 s with an angular velocity of the input shaft of 52.34 rad/s (500 RPM).

Opis:
In order to deal with undesirable products in models of performance analysis, we need to replace the assumption of free disposability by weak disposability and this assumption has been used to model undesirable products as outputs. The traditional axiom of weak disposability of Shephard (1970) is given in a multiplier form and, in this sense, the level of bad outputs is equal to zero if and only if the level of the desirable outputs is equal to zero. An alternative definition of the weak disposability of outputs in additive form has been proposed. An axiomatic foundation has been introduced to construct a new production technology space in the presence of undesirable outputs. The model is illustrated using real data from 92 coal fired power plants.

Opis:
In commercially available generation III and III+ PWR (pressurized water reactor) reactors, pressure of steam produced in steam generators varies in a relatively wide range from 5.7 to 7.8 MPa. Therefore, it is important to ask which value of steam pressure should be used for a specific unit, taking into account different location conditions, the size of the power system and conditions of operation with other sources of electricity generation. The paper analyzes the effect of steam pressure at the outlet of a steam generator on the performance of a PWR nuclear power plant by presenting changes in gross and net power and efficiency of the unit for steam pressures in the range of 6.8 to 7.8 MPa. In order to determine losses in the thermal system of the PWR power plant, in particular those caused by flow resistance and live steam throttling between the steam generator and the turbine inlet, results concerning entropy generation in the thermal system of the power plant have been presented. A model of a nuclear power plant was developed using the Ebsilon software and validated based on data concerning the Olkiluoto Unit 3 EPR (evolutionary power reactor) power plant. The calculations in the model were done for design conditions and for a constant thermal power of the steam generator. Under nominal conditions of the Olkiluoto Unit 3 EPR power unit, steam pressure is about 7.8 MPa and the steam dryness fraction is 0.997. The analysis indicates that in the assumed range of live steam pressure the gross power output and efficiency increase by 32 MW and 0.735 percentage point, respectively, and the net power output and efficiency increase by 27.8 MW and 0.638 percentage point, respectively. In the case of all types of commercially available PWR reactors, water pressure in the primary circuit is in the range of 15.5−16.0 MPa. For such pressure, reducing the live steam pressure leads to a reduction in the efficiency of the unit. Although a higher steam pressure increases the efficiency of the system, it is necessary to take into account the limitations resulting from technical and economic criteria as well as operating conditions of the primary circuit, including the necessary DNBR (departure from nucleate boiling ratio) margin. For the above reasons, increasing the live steam pressure above 7.8 MPa (the value used in EPR units that have already been completed) is unjustified, as it is associated with higher costs of the steam generator and the high-pressure part of the turbine.

Opis:
Nowadays, there is a need for charging electric vehicles (EVs) wirelessly, since it provides a more convenient, reliable, and safer charging option for the EV customers. A wireless charging system using a double-sided LCC compensation topology is proven to be highly efficient; however, the large volume induced by the compensation coils is a drawback. Endocrine links are more useful in transmitting power wirelessly than other links. These links are used in the transmission of low and medium power. In this paper, by analyzing the equivalent circuit of a WPT power transmission system, the optimal value of the inductance was formulated to increase the yield. This can have other applications. In order to neutralize the reactive losses, the series resonance is used in both in primary and secondary sections, among which the lower quantities of series inductors were selected from the initial values to increase the efficiency and power. Furthermore, it is possible to optimize these values using suitable optimization methods. In this study, the PSO algorithm was used for this purpose.
